[1] 다음이 설명하는 파일 시스템의 문제점은 무엇인가?
응용 프로그램이 파일에 직접 접근하여 데이터를 처리해야 하므로 파일의 데이터 구성 방법이나 물리적인 저장 구조에 맞게 응용 프로그램을 작성해야 하고, 파일의 구조가 변경되면 응용 프로그램도 함께 변경해야 한다. |
- 데이터 중복성
- 데이터 독립성
- 데이터 변경성
- 데이터 종속성
[정답]④
파일 시스템의 문제점은
- 같은 내용의 데이터가 여러번 중복됨(데이터의 중복성)
- 응용프로그램이 데이터파일에 종속적(데이터 종속성) - 사용하는 파일 구조에 맞게 응용 프로그램을 변경해야하므로
- 데이터파일의 동시공유, 보안, 회복기능 부족
- 응용 프로그램 개발 어려움
따라서 데이터 종속성에 대한 설명입니다.
[2]데이터베이스 관리 시스템의 주요 기능이 아닌 것은?
- 정의 기능
- 조작 기능
- 제어 기능
- 절차 기능
[정답]④
DBMS의 주요 기능은 정의, 조작, 제어 기능 입니다.
[3] 다음은 데이터베이스 관리 시스템의 주요 기능 중 무엇에 대한 설명인가?
사용자 요구에 따라 데이터베이스에 저장된 데이터에 접근하여 삽입, 삭제, 수정, 검색 연산을 정확하고 효율적으로 수행한다. |
- 정의 기능
- 조작 기능
- 제어 기능
- 연산 기능
[정답]②
정의 기능 - 데이터의 구조를 정의하거나 수정
조작 기능 - 데이터를 삽입, 삭제, 수정, 검색 연산을 함
제어 기능 - 데이터를 정확하고 안전하게 유지
따라서 답은 조작기능 입니다.
[4] 데이터베이스 관리 시스템의 주요 기능인 제어 기능에 대한 설명으로 옳지 않은 것은?
- 연산을 수행한 후에도 데이터의 일관성과 무결성을 유지한다.
- 여러 사용자가 데이터베이스에 동시에 접근하여 데이터를 처리할 수 있도록 제어한다.
- 데이터베이스의 구조를 정의하거나 수정한다.
- 정당한 사용자가 허가된 데이터에만 접근할 수 있도록 보안을 유지한다.
[정답]③
3번은 정의기능과 관련된 내용 입니다.
[5] 데이터베이스 관리 시스템의 장점으로 보기 어려운 것은?
- 데이터 중복을 통제할 수 있다
- 데이터 보안이 향상된다
- 백업과 회복 방법이 간단하다.
- 데이터 무결성을 유지할 수 있다
[정답]③
DBMS의 단점은
1. 비용이 많이 듬.(구매비용)
2. 백업과 회복이 복잡하다.
따라서 답은 3번입니다.
[6] 데이터베이스 관리 시스템의 단점으로 가장 적합한 것은?
- 표준화가 어렵다
- 응용 프로그램의 개발 비용이 많이 든다
- 데이터 독립성을 호가보하기 어렵다
- 백업과 회복 기법이 복잡하다.
[정답]④
5번 문제와 비슷한 맥락으로 4번이 정답입니다.
[7] 다음과 같은 특징이 있는 데이터베이스 관리 시스템의 유형은?
데이터베이스를 노드와 간선을 이용한 그래프 형태로 구성하는 데이터모델을 사용한다 데이터베이스의 구조가 복잡하고 변경이 어렵다는 단점이 있다. |
- 네트워크 데이터베이스 관리 시스템
- 계층 데이터베이스 관리 시스템
- 관계 데이터베이스 관리 시스템
- 객체지향 데이터베이스 관리 시스템
[정답]②노드와 간선을 이용한 그래프 형태의 데이터모델은1세대 DBMS로 계층 데이터베이스 관리 시스템 입니다
[정답]1
노드와 간선을 이용한 그래프 형태의 데이터모델은
네트워크 DBMS입니다.
[8] 다음은 어떤 유형의 데이터베이스 관리 시스템으로 분류할 수 있는가?
오라클, MS SQL 서버, 엑세스, 인포믹스, Mysql |
- 네트워크 데이터베이스 관리 시스템
- 계층 데이터베이스 관리 시스템
- 관계 데이터베이스 관리 시스템
- 객체지향 데이터베이스 관리 시스템
[정답]③
위에 나열된 예시들은 현재 가장 많이 쓰이는 DBMS로 2세대 관계 데이터베이스 관리 시스템 입니다.
[9] 데이터를 파일로 관리하기 위해 파일을 생성, 삭제, 수정, 검색하는 기능을 제공하는 소프트웨어를 무엇이라 하는가?
[정답]파일시스템
[10] 파일 시스템의 문제점을 설명하시오.
[정답]
- 데이터 중복이 발생하여 데이터의 일관성과 무결성 유지 어려움
- 응용프로그램이 데이터 파일에 종속적
- 데이터 파일 동시 공유, 보안 회복기능 부족
- 응용 프로그램 개발 어려움
[11] DBMS가 무엇인지 설명하시오.
[정답]
파일 시스템의 대체로 나온 소프트웨어이며, 조직에 필요한 데이터를 DB에 통합하여 저장해서 관리 합니다.
[12] DBMS의 세가지 주요기능을 설명하시오.
[정답]
정의 기능 - 데이터베이스의 구조를 정의하거나 수정함
조작기능 - 데이터의 삽입,수정,검색 등 연산을 수행함
제어기능 - 데이터의 무결성과 보안을 담당함.
[13] DMBS를 사용함으로써 얻게 되는 장점을 설명하시오.
[정답]
주로 파일시스템의 단점을 보완한 것으로,
데이터의 무결성 유지가 가능하고,
표준화가 가능하며,
응용프로그램 개발비용이 줄어들며,
데이터 보안이 향상됩니다.
'공부 정리 > 데이터베이스개론' 카테고리의 다른 글
[데이터베이스개론] 6장 연습문제 (4) | 2021.11.29 |
---|---|
[데이터베이스개론] 5장 연습문제 (2) | 2021.11.25 |
[데이터베이스개론] 4장 연습문제 (0) | 2021.11.24 |
[데이터베이스개론] 3장 연습문제 (0) | 2021.11.23 |
[데이터베이스개론] 1장 연습문제 (1) | 2021.11.18 |
댓글